Abstract
Rhegmatogenous Retinal Detachment (RRD) is a severe ocular condition characterized by the detachment of the neurosensory retina from the retinal pigment epithelium and caused by retinal tears. Pars Plana Vitrectomy (PPV) is the standard surgical procedure for RRD, and is intended to remove the vitreous gel, which shapes the eye, and provides mechanical and nutritional support to the retina. The study of the vitreous proteome isolated from RRD patients may help decipher the pathobiology of the disease and that of its complications, such as proliferative vitreo-retinopathy (PVR), which predispose to recurrent retinal detachment (observed in 20% of cases), a sight threatening condition.
